You are invited to camp on what was once a golf course, and always has been surrounded by natural bushland.
Situated only 20 minutes from Canberra, we offer you the opportunity to escape from the hustle and bustle of the city and immerse yourself in a peaceful country experience.
There are dams to camp near, and a beautiful nature reserve where you can take a peaceful walk. If you would like to have a wander and experience some untouched bushland, please ask and we can provide simple directions.
Bird watching and wildlife observation is unavoidable, and we recommend downloading the ACT Field Guide app. Enjoy your morning coffee surrounded by kangaroos and cockatoos.
Suitable for Tents, Campers, Vans and Caravans, with good access for 2WD and caravans.
Must have own amenities. There are no toilets on site and you need to take everything away with you.
Small campfires are permitted in designated areas, when restrictions aren't in place. You may use dead wood that you find on the golf course area as firewood. Please do not gather firewood from the nature reserve, for wildlife's sake.
Pets are not permitted.
